Reporting to the Talent and Culture Lead, Egypt, this is a newly created role that will have a big impact on the business, so we need a high energy individual to join a dynamic team. In return, you will have the opportunity to not only contribute to the success of the business but also develop a strong career as opportunities present themselves over the coming years.

This role supports Egypt Marketing population.

Key Accountabilities:


  • Partners with the Talent Acquisition on the strategic workforce plan, including review of business plan, key workforce trends and implications and internal capacities
  • Manages the planning, execution and evaluation of in market Talent Development programs for driving continuous improvement
  • Facilitates and manages the Performance Development learning and application on HR systems
  • Plans, organizes and facilitates workshops and training sessions as required
  • Maintains and builds Talent Development platforms and ensure knowledge and learners data retention
  • Validates and completes approval cycles for in-market and above market job assignments and global/ area offerings and inclusion
  • Helps implements talent pipeline planning approaches to ensure robust succession plans, quality talent pools and early identification of key leadership pipeline gaps
  • Cultivates a culture of learning and continues to position AZ as House of Development
  • Partners with the Talent Acquisition on Social media employer branding and Provide guidance and support to early talent programs (for example support with annual workshops, induction events etc.)
  • Delivers activities to accelerate the development of our high potential employees
  • Contributes to building and maintaining Talent dashboards within the area you support and measuring return on investment
  • When required, supports your area with Talent & Development related projects
  • Supports the running of development weeks and the development element of Town Halls
  • Supports with the preparation of Talent Reviews and engagement plans
  • Analyzes, generates insights on Semi- annual employee pulse survey, partners with the Business and HR leads in driving continuous improvement plans
  • Reviews and proposes updates policies and guidelines for Talent Development, career progression, program designs and performance management as convenient
  • Cultivates Extra mile recognition culture, analyzes Recognition award, generates insights and development areas and manage in country recognition ceremonies and events in partnership with Internal communication and events team


Your Experience:


  • Have more than 5 Years of Strong track of Talent Development expertise in a multinational organization
  • Solid experience in training facilitation, advising and knowledge delivery across diverse career levels
  • Ability to analyze data, generate insights and develop impactful developmental interventions
  • Collaboration and influencing skills to create partnerships to implement change; consistently displays a readiness and willingness to share knowledge; is open to different perspectives and to building consensus
  • Believe in and champion our values and actively strive to build a culture of inclusion and diversity
  • Critical thinker, demonstrate flexibility and able to lead projects and cross-functional interventions
